Two bottom-up techniques suitable for the formation of regular nanopatterns on\r\ndifferent length scales are nanosphere lithography (NSL) and block copolymer (BCP) lithography. In this\r\npaper it is shown that NSL and BCP lithography can be combined to easily design hierarchically nanopatterned\r\nsurfaces of different materials. Nanosphere lithography is used for the pre-patterning of\r\nsurfaces with antidots, i.e. hexagonally arranged cylindrical holes in thin films of Au, Pt and TiO2 on SiO2,\r\nproviding a periodic chemical and topographical contrast on the surface suitable for templating in subsequent\r\nBCP lithography. PS-b-PMMA BCP is used in the second self-assembly step to form hexagonally\r\narranged nanopores with sub-20 nm diameter within the antidots upon microphase separation. To\r\nachieve this the microphase separation of BCP on planar surfaces is studied, too, and it is demonstrated\r\nfor the first time that vertical BCP nanopores can be formed on TiO2, Au and Pt films without using any\r\nneutralization layers. To explain this the influence of surface energy, polarity and roughness on the microphase\r\nseparation is investigated and discussed along with the wetting state of BCP on NSL-pre-patterned\r\nsurfaces. The presented novel route for the creation of advanced hierarchical nanopatterns is easily applicable\r\non large-area surfaces of different materials. The covalent functionalization was demonstrated with NMR and AFM-IR. The resulting structure\r\nand particle size was measured with AFM and HRTEM. The thermal stability of the compound was\r\ninvestigated and showed a stability of up to 220 °C. The modified graphene oxide quantum dots showed\r\nexcellent solubility in various organic solvents, including ethers, methanol, toluene, n-hexane, heptane,\r\nxylene, dichloromethane and toluene. The stability of a resulting toluene solution was also proven by\r\nstatic light scattering measurements over several days. The excellent solubility gives the possibility of an\r\nefficient and fast spray application of the functionalized graphene oxide quantum dots to steel surfaces.\r\nHence, the macroscopic friction behavior was investigated with a Thwing-Albert FP-2250 friction tester. Most known structuring\r\nmethods are either complex and hardly upscalable or do not apply to biological matter at all. The presented combination of enzyme mediated autodeposition and nanosphere lithography provides an easy-to-apply approach for the buildup of protein nanostructures over a large scale. The key factor is the tethering of enzyme to the support in designated areas. Those areas are provided via prepatterning of enzymatically active antidots with variable diameters. Enzymatically triggered protein addressing occurs exclusively at the intended areas and continues until the entire active area is coated. After this, the reaction self-terminates. The major advantage of the presented method lies in its easy applicability and upscalability. Large area structuring of entire support surfaces with features on the nanometer scale is performed efficiently and without the necessity of harsh conditions.
